Definitions:

Mental Status

A comprehensive assessment of a patient's level of cognitive functioning, including appearance, mood, thought processes, and perceptions.

Danger To Self

A term used to describe a situation or condition where an individual poses a risk of harm to their own well-being or life.

Clinical Judgment

The process by which healthcare professionals make decisions based on their expertise, knowledge, and patient observations.

Statistical Decision-making Model

A framework used to make decisions under uncertainty by applying statistical and probabilistic methods to analyze and weigh different possible outcomes.
